  • Patent number: 10213702
    Abstract: Disclosed is a toy racetrack having a toy vehicle launching section that, in a first configuration of the racetrack, launches a toy vehicle toward and through the open, central portion of a loop track section, preferably to impact a target, and in a transformed configuration of the racetrack, launches a toy vehicle through the track portion of the loop track section and preferably toward a catch tray. Two loop track sections are pivotably mounted to a tower, and target flags may be pivotably mounted to a loop section mounting block positioned at the top of the tower. Once one of the target flags is struck by a toy vehicle, an internal transformation mechanism is triggered that causes the loop track sections to pivot into a track engaging position in which the loop sections form terminal track portions for the track segments in the launching section of the racetrack.

  • Patent number: 9707490
    Abstract: Disclosed is a convertible toy vehicle playset convertible from a first configuration to a second, altered configuration upon a predefined interaction with a toy vehicle. A convertible track segment includes a rotating platform mounted above a base and a trigger located on the rotating platform that may be engaged by a toy vehicle. The trigger is configured to cause the convertible track segment to undergo a transformation from a section of a toy track set to an alternative structure, such as a display trophy with the toy vehicle positioned atop the trophy, which transformation occurs only when the rotating platform is within a specific, predetermined rotational angle range with respect to the base.

  • Patent number: 9707488
    Abstract: A toy vehicle is disclosed that is configured to be driven by a pull cord that is inserted through the axle of a drive wheel of the toy vehicle, such that the drive wheel of the toy vehicle is energized through movement of the driving pull cord in a direction that is generally perpendicular to the direction of intended travel of the toy vehicle. This configuration allows a user to launch multiple toy vehicles arranged in a side-by-side arrangement using a single pull cord, and moreover by pulling such single pull cord through a single pull stroke. This configuration also allows the simultaneous launching of multiple toy vehicles aligned in a single row when multiple pull cords are provided an engage a single actuator to withdraw all such pull cords in a single pulling stroke. Launchers for use with such a toy vehicle, and methods of using the same, are also disclosed.

  • Patent number: 9114323
    Abstract: In one exemplary embodiment, a toy vehicle track set for use with at least one toy vehicle is provided, the toy vehicle track set having: a first vehicle path through the toy vehicle track set when the toy vehicle track set is in a first configuration; a second vehicle path through the toy vehicle track set when the toy vehicle track set is in a second configuration; and a trigger mechanism for converting the toy vehicle track set from the first configuration into the second configuration, wherein the trigger mechanism is actuated by a toy vehicle travelling along only one of two paths of the first vehicle path.

  • Patent number: 8926396
    Abstract: An inertia motor for a toy has a housing supporting a rotating flywheel. The flywheel has a disk with generally radially movable elements, movement of which vary the moment of inertia of the disk. Another element is supported by the housing so as to be movable towards and away from the disk and is located so as to be able to engage at least one of the movable elements when the flywheel has slowed sufficiently. Angular momentum and energy in the flywheel at engagement is transferred to the housing. The housing may also include a transmission such as a gear train to connect the flywheel with one of more elements of the toy to be powered by the flywheel.

  • Publication number: 20140256219
    Abstract: A toy vehicle launch apparatus is described. The launch apparatus comprises a base, a vehicle tray, an actuator, a launch member, and a release controller. The vehicle tray is coupled to the base such that it is rotatable along a longitudinal axis relative to the base. The actuator, launch member, and release controller are coupled such that the launch member is configured to move between a ready position and a released position along a surface of the vehicle tray. The apparatus may also include a vehicle disposed on a surface of the vehicle tray and positioned in a launch position adjacent to the launch member. A combination toy vehicle transporter and launch apparatus and a method of launching a vehicle are also disclosed.
